William Chalmers, Swedish merchant and freemason, late 18th or 19th century. The son of a Scottish merchant and his Swedish wife, William Chalmers (1748-1811) was a director of the Swedish East India Company. In 1783 he was appointed the company's representative in Canton, remaining there and in Macau for ten years before returning to Sweden.
